One day after a blizzard snapped 270 Omaha Public Power District utility poles and left tens of thousands of customers without electricity, officials said it could take until Monday before power is fully restored to all.

Crews were able to restore power to 70% of customers overnight Wednesday and 300 mutual aid crews joined the effort on Thursday, essentially doubling OPPD’s headcount, said Shannon Ankeny, an OPPD spokesperson.

“We do have some really good progress that was made throughout the day,” Ankeny said.

About 26,000 OPPD customers remained without power around 5:30 p.m. Thursday. That was significantly down from a peak of around 95,000 customers who lost power in the Wednesday storm.
